[QUOTE="Good-Guy, post: 204873, member: 29109"] The field of business studies is quite interesting. It is a really good field and it is quite broad. There are many branches of business studies and there are many people who pursue a Master's degree in business. What many people should realize that a Master's degree in business also have many sub-categories. You could try to get a Master's Degree in finance, Marketing, management, etc. I am particularly concerned about MBA (Master's In Business Administration) in marketing. I think people who get a Master's degree in marketing tend to become marketing manager or pursue a career in marketing field. Some people have suggested that it is much better to pursue a career in finance. I am not sure what exactly is the difference but I think these are two different fields within the subject of Business. I think the kind of job you receive after completing MBA in marketing depends on the job market in your country. If there are not many jobs in the marketing sector, then you will struggle to find a job even after completing your master's and this is the reason why many people are unemployed in my country. So do you think that getting a Master's degree in marketing is actually beneficial? [/QUOTE]
